Selling a Family Home This Summer?

As school holidays approach, family buyers often become more focused. For sellers with space, gardens or flexible rooms, July can be a useful moment to attract motivated movers.

For parents, moving home is rarely just about finding more space. It is about timing, routine, schools, childcare, work patterns and making the next move feel manageable for everyone involved. As the school holidays arrive, many families start thinking seriously about whether their current home still works for them.
 
Some may want more bedrooms. Others may need a larger garden, a home office, better storage, parking, or a layout that makes busy family life easier. For sellers whose homes offer these features, summer can be a strong time to stand out.
 
That does not mean every family buyer is ready to complete before September. In reality, moving home takes time but the holidays can give families more breathing space to view properties, discuss plans and make decisions without the usual school-week pressure.
This is where presentation becomes important.
 
Family buyers are often looking for a home that feels practical as well as attractive. They want to imagine school bags by the door, meals around the table, children playing outside, quiet corners for homework and enough storage to keep everyday life organised.
 
If you are preparing to sell a family home, think about how each room is being used. A spare bedroom might be shown as a nursery, guest room or study. A dining area can help buyers picture family meals. A garden should feel safe, usable and easy to enjoy. Storage cupboards, utility areas and parking should not be overlooked, because these are often the details that make a home feel liveable.
 
The wider market also matters. Rightmove’s June 2026 House Price Index reported that the average newly listed asking price fell by 0.6% to £376,191, the biggest June drop in 14 years. It also reported that buyer demand in May was 10% lower than a year earlier, while the number of homes for sale remained historically high for this time of year. 
 
For sellers, this means pricing and positioning need to be handled carefully. Family buyers may be motivated, but they are also comparing more homes and thinking carefully about affordability. A property that feels overpriced may be dismissed quickly, even if it has the right space.
 
The good news is that family-friendly homes can still attract strong interest when they are priced sensibly and marketed clearly. Buyers will often pay attention to homes that solve a real problem for them, whether that is extra space, a better layout, a garden, or room to grow.
 
July also gives sellers the benefit of longer viewing windows and better natural light. Homes can photograph well, gardens look more inviting, and evening viewings can feel easier to arrange. But summer also brings distractions, from holidays to childcare arrangements, so it is important to make your listing work hard from day one.
 
Before going live, sellers should ask three practical questions. Does the price reflect the current market? Does the marketing explain who the home is ideal for? Does the property feel ready for viewings?
 
Small improvements can make a big difference. Decluttering children’s rooms, tidying the garden, cleaning windows, freshening paintwork and making the entrance feel welcoming can all help a buyer picture themselves living there.
 
Family buyers are often emotional decision-makers, but they are also practical. They need to feel that the move is worth the effort.
